Grove City HomesteadGrove City is a suburban community located approximately 10 miles southwest of downtown Columbus. It is home to about 36,000 residents. While Grove City originated as a pioneer village in the 1850’s, it’s best known today as a growing economic hub with over 1,000 businesses. Grove City boasts major employers and distribution centers, featuring companies like Merrill Corporation and Pier 1 Imports.

Grove City’s business growth has not compromised the small-town feel of the historic Town Center. This walkable, downtown area is well-kept and seasonally decorated. It is home to The Little Theater Off Broadway and many unique stores and restaurants. The Town Center hosts community gatherings and festivals throughout the year, including a farmer’s market, summer concerts, a wine and arts festival and holiday events.

The Grove City public park system contributes to the excellent quality of life enjoyed by residents, with about 500 acres of managed parkland and facilities. The park system offers recreational programming for aquatics, environmental education, preschool classes, youth and teen enrichment, child care, gardening and special events. There are various sports programs for youth, teens and adults, as well as senior activities.

Grove City also has 25 miles of paved bicycle trails and routes. These routes provide safe access and recreation for bicyclists, pedestrians and inline skaters.

Public education in Grove City is provided by the South-Western City Schools District. Two of the districts four high schools are located in Grove City: Grove City High School and Central Crossing. These well-regarded high schools offer educational and cultural diversity, and feature an abundance of extracurricular activities. There are also five elementary schools in Grove City, along with two middle schools.

The Grove City Center for Higher Education and Harrison College offer a wealth of degree programs and opportunities for continuing education.
